site stats

Dva 函数

Web11 apr 2024 · redux 提供了 combineReducers 辅助函数,可将独立分散的 reducer 合并成一个最终的 reducer 函数,然后在创建 store 时作为 createStore 的参数传入。 我们可以根据业务需要,把所有子 reducer 放在不同的目录下,然后在在一个文件里面统一引入,最后将合并后的 reducer 导出: Web19 nov 2024 · 该函数把一个集合归并成一个单值。 Reducer 的概念来自于是函数式编程,在 dva 中, reducers 聚合积累的结果是当前 model 的 state 对象 。 通过 actions 中传入的值,与当前 reducers 中的值进行运算获得新的值(也就是新的 state)。 注意:Reducer函数必须是纯函数。 Effects异步处理

Dva中实现异步effect的原理分析 - 掘金 - 稀土掘金

Web9 ott 2024 · 首先给出简介: 以 key/value 格式定义 effect。 用于处理异步操作和业务逻辑,不直接修改 state。 由 action 触发,可以触发 action,可以和服务器交互,可以获取 … WebDva 是什么 dva 首先是一个基于redux和redux-saga的数据流方案,然后为了简化开发体验,dva 还额外内置了react-router和fetch,所以也可以理解为一个轻量级的应用框架 tarif bunga pajak mei 2022 https://desdoeshairnyc.com

React dva 的使用 - 贝尔塔猫 - 博客园

http://geekdaxue.co/read/byhh6u@adsf2s/rbskdw WebDva. Dva - 起步; Vue. Vue3.0; Vue - 生命周期; 发布订阅模式; Vue创建命令; Vue路由搭建; React. TypeScript. ts图片预览; React路由配置; React antd按需加载; React常用配置; React Ts 路由; React Ts 配置别名; JavaScript. JS - 拷贝; JS - 类; JS- Reflect; JS - Proxy; 键盘事件,点击触发; 引用库 ... http://geekdaxue.co/read/pmtce8@prwa2u/yp4ag6 食べ物 ブランド化

dva分享 - EricYin的博客 Eric

Category:Dva的Effects接受的参数_dva effects参数_慢半拍、的博客-CSDN博客

Tags:Dva 函数

Dva 函数

Redux基本概念 - 掘金 - 稀土掘金

Web请下载您需要的格式的文档,随时随地,享受汲取知识的乐趣!

Dva 函数

Did you know?

Web我们的源码分析流程是这样的:通过一个使用 dva 开发的例子,随着其对 dva 函数的逐步调用,来分析内部 dva 相关函数的实现原理。 我们分析采用的例子是 dva 官方提供的一 … Web1、什么是 dva React 应用级框架,将 React-Router + Redux + Redux-saga 三个 React 工具库包装在一起,简化了 API,让开发 React 应用更加方便和快捷 简单理解:dva = …

Web这个函数也有副作用,就是依赖外部的环境,b 在别处被改变了,返回值对于相同的 a 就有可能不一样。 而 Reducer 是一个纯函数,对于相同的输入,永远都只会有相同的输出,不会影响外部的变量,也不会被外部变量影响,不得改写参数。 Web14 giu 2024 · dva 是一个基于 redux 和 redux-saga 的数据流方案,然后为了简化开发体验,dva 还额外内置了 react-router 和 fetch,所以也可以理解为一个轻量级的应用框架。简 …

Web此时dva已安装成功,通过 dva 命令 dva new 创建一个新应用 $ dva new dva - demoOne 这样会创建一个名为 dva-demoOne 的项目文件,包含项目初始化目录和文件,主要为 … Web一、Dva简单介绍基于 redux 和 redux-saga 的数据流方案。 实际上就是集成了react的一些库,包括react、react-dom、react-router-dom、connected-react-router、redux、redux …

Web11 apr 2024 · dva 首先是一个基于 redux 和 redux-saga 的数据流方案,然后为了简化开发体验,dva 还额外内置了 react-router 和 fetch ,所以也可以理解为一个轻量级的应用框架。 dva主要是为了降低组件之间耦合,简化元素,来降低开发难度。 数据流向: 数据的改变发生通常是通过用户交互行为或者浏览器跳转行为来触发。 这里图简单解读一下,通过 …

Webdva是一个基于 redux 和 redux-saga 的数据流方案,其中effects是Action 处理器,处理异步动作,基于 Redux-saga 实现。 Effect 指的是副作用。 根据函数式编程,计算以外的操 … 食べ物 ブランド 日本Web14 lug 2024 · 5. 定义项目路由. 由于 dva与umi 通过 umi-plugin-dva 插件相结合, 使用起来非常方便. dva 是什么呢? 看这里: 链接描述 umi 是什么呢? 看这里: 链接描述 dva 与 umi … tarif bunga pajak november 2022Web函数式编程. 深拷贝函数; compose函数; 柯理化; Webpack. Tree Shaking 原理; 代码分割原理; SourceMap; 热跟新原理; 浏览器原理; Babel. 目标引擎的browserslist 查询; core-js; CSS. Css选择器; 算法与复杂度; 设计模式; JS 基础. Web API; Intersection-Observer; 检测函数是否为类(new)调用 ... tarif bunga pasal 9 2a kupWebDva 是什么 dva 首先是一个基于redux和redux-saga的数据流方案,然后为了简化开发体验,dva 还额外内置了react-router和fetch,所以也可以理解为一个轻量级的应用框架 tarif bunga pajak mei 2021Web18 lug 2010 · dva的几个规则: 1、通过dispatch调用namespace/effects 2、state(状态) 3、effects (异步操作) - 函数必须带*,也就是生成器。 - 第一个参数,可以拓展为{payload, … 食べ物 フリー素材Webdva中通过定义 model来声明各模块的状态,其中 reducers就是 redux的 reducers,effects就是用来执行异步操作的地方,在 effect中最终也会通过 reducers将状态更新到 state中。 cosnt model = { state: {}, effects: { getList() {} } reducers: { merge() {} } } 基本使用 使用方法同 redux 使用 connect高阶函数或者 useSelector来获取 state 使用 connect或者 useDispatch … 食べ物 フリー素材サイトWeb7 giu 2024 · dispatch 函数 type dispatch = (a: Action) => Action dispatching function 是一个用于触发 action 的函数,action 是改变 State 的唯一途径,但是它只描述了一个行为,而 dipatch 可以看作是触发这个行为的方式,而 Reducer 则是描述如何改变数据的。 在 dva 中,connect Model 的组件通过 props 可以访问到 dispatch,可以调用 Model 中的 Reducer … tarif bunga pasal 8 2 kup